Dapper Dad-Stamp a Stack card #2

This is the second card I wanted to share from my previous All Ocassions Stamp a Stack this past month. 
I saw a card similar to this in some colors I don't use, so I decided why not switch out the colors and make it something I like.  This stamp set wasn't one of my first choices when the mini catalog came out, but it grew on me, like most stamp sets do over time, lol.  I don't have enough stamp sets for masculine use, and this one has three images that are PERFECT for just that.  I started by using Very Vanilla cardstock as my base and layering it with the much forgotten Chocolate Chip cardstock and then a layer of Crumb Cake ran through the Lattice embossing folder.  I stamped the bow tie once onto a square of Very Vanilla and then on a scrap piece of VV and cut that one out and popped it up on Dimensionals and added some brads to the four corners and adhered it down to a layer of Chocolate Chip.  I then stamped the sentiment from the Perfectly Penned stamped set in Chocolate Chip onto Very Vanilla and sponged the edges and also adhered it with Dimensionals.
